Seminar On Interleave Division Multiple Access (IDMA)
Abstract: 
In this paper, we study a multiple access scheme referred to as interleave-division multipleaccess
(IDMA), in which interleavers are used as the only means for user separation. IDMA inherits many advantages from CDMA, such as diversity against fading and mitigation of the worst-case other-cell user interference problem. A low-cost iterative chip-by-chip multi-user detection algorithm is described with
complexity independent of the user number and increasing linearly with the path number. The advantages of low-rate coded systems are demonstrated using analytical and simulation results. Throughput of 3 bits/chip is observed with one receive antenna and 6 bits/chip with two receive antennas in multipath channels. Performance in a Gaussian multiple access channel at 1.4 dB away from the theoretical limit is demonstrated. These low-cost, high performance advantages can be maintained in asynchronous multipath environments.
Keywords: CDMA, channel capacity, iterative decoding, multi-user detection.
